Need Help! Noise after new oil pump
Whats up Evom, I need some help/advice here. I just recently put a new oil pump on my 06 evo mr. Timed everything up and all looked good. Primed the new oil pump just to be sure and once I turned on the car for the first time I am now getting a loud intermittant ticking noise followed by the oil light. I only ran the motor for about 10 seconds then heard the noise and turned it off. no check engine light just the oil light comes on when the noise occurs then goes off once the noise stops sounds like its coming from the mivec gear idk what it is take a look at the video attached. Any and all help would be greatly appreciated let me know what you think. Thanks all!!

Update, pulled off oil filter and lines and found that I am not getting any oil to my engine. Even after I primed the oil pump using a small drill on the pump gear and spinning it to get oil into the head. Anyone have any idea?

when you primed the oil pump did you check that you got the oil or did you just spin it for a couple of sec?
how did you prime it ?
did you pack the new pump with some assembly lube or oil at least?
ticking noise is your lifters / mivec running without oil

Yeah I spun the oil pump gear for quite a bit and allowed oil to come up to the head out of the lifters you could see the oil spraying. Then also disconnected ignition and let the car crank about 4 times prior to starting. Case/Pump was full of lube right out of the box
